Police Commando Competition begins in Assam

Diphu: The ninth All India Police Commando Competition, organised under the aegis of Assam Rifles was inaugurated by Meghalaya Governor Tathagata Roy at Karbi Anglong Sports Association (KASA) Stadium at Karbi Anglong district headquarters here in Assam, officials said.
Speaking on the occasion, Roy said the competition’s main aim is to improve the standard of professional performance of the police forces of the country.
Appreciating the endeavour of the Assam Riffles for organising the competition, Roy said the country’s oldest paramilitary force has lived up to its credo of being ‘Friends of the North East’.
A total of 22 teams – eight central armed police forces (CAPF) teams and 14 state police force teams are participating in the event, an Assam Rifles official said.
A team of 21 paratroopers displayed their skills at the programme, he said.
The Chief Executive Member of Karbi Anglong Autonomous Council, the district Deputy Commissioner and Superintendent of Police were also present at the inaugural ceremony on Wednesday. (PTI)
